Output 834589352b1fbd9995d44d49416e1405debba4c3c8fdb5e04f69071a2b59ce41:1

value
1838000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d69760a3fef99665516949869128f6be8abf71c OP_EQUALVERIFY OP_CHECKSIG
address
1MBifxfj6NryiGXeJGCFS4RKLiRD1uNzR5
transaction
834589352b1fbd9995d44d49416e1405debba4c3c8fdb5e04f69071a2b59ce41
spent
true